    Ice Skating Tips for Beginners

    If you are new to ice skating, here are a few tips to help you get started: * **Wear comfortable clothing.** You will be doing a lot of moving around, so make sure you wear clothes that you can move easily in. * **Bring gloves.** Gloves will help to keep your hands warm and prevent blisters. * **Start slowly.** Dont try to do too much too soon. Start by skating around the rink slowly and gradually increase your speed as you become more comfortable. * **Dont be afraid to fall.** Everyone falls when they first start ice skating. Just get back up and try again.

    Ice Skating Safety

    Ice skating is a safe activity, but there are a few things you can do to reduce your risk of injury: * **Wear a helmet.** A helmet can help to protect your head in the event of a fall. * **Skate on a well-maintained rink.** Make sure the rink is free of cracks and other hazards. * **Be aware of your surroundings.** Be aware of other skaters and avoid collisions.
